mysql8.0安全策略

1
密码规定:数字英文大小写加特殊符号组成(可以不按照规则,详情去百度设置) 2.
mysql数据库用户密码字段不再是password
而是authentication_string 3
安装后进入 my.cnf文件修改在[mysql]字段后面加入skip-grants-table
重启后进入mysql
执行这条命令:(此处可以不填密码)
update mysql.user set authentication_string='newpassword' where user='root' 4
如果出现没密码正确无法登陆
1.0
因为mysql本身加密方式为plugin: caching_sha2_password
可以在my.cnf文件里面把#authentication_string=mysql_native_password前面的#号去掉再修改密码
2.0可以开启Alter USER 'root'@‘localhost’ IDENTIFIED WITH mysql_native_password BY '新密码';
来设置密码加方式插件 navicat加密方式为md5;
5退出mysql把文件m.cnf里面的skip-grants-table注释掉,重启,即可用修改后的密码登录

最新文章

  1. HTC Vive开发笔记之手柄震动
  2. shell脚本去重的几种方法
  3. 转:printf打印输出2进制
  4. C++ Primer : 第十二章 : 文本查询程序
  5. 【spring 5】AOP:spring中对于AOP的的实现
  6. hbase查询,scan详解
  7. win7 安装Oracle 10G,11G
  8. 粒子系统1:简介&工具使用
  9. java 串口通信 代码
  10. careercup-排序和查找 11.4
  11. yum命令学习
  12. 从零开始学C++之STL(四):算法简介、7种算法分类
  13. 傻瓜式使用AutoFac
  14. Objective-C AVPlayer播放视频的使用与封装
  15. Windows核心编程&作业
  16. [转] vue之computed和watch
  17. Vue.js学习使用心得(一)
  18. SPSS-聚类分析
  19. [转]收藏的Extjs 多表头插件GroupHeaderGrid
  20. 形成一个zigzag数组(JPEG编码里取像素数据的排列顺序)

热门文章

  1. 网络损伤仪WANsim的带宽限制功能
  2. python批量修改图片名称
  3. URL 参数为sql 有空格 的解决办法
  4. 仅用CSS实现图片渲染特效 (有学习到了)
  5. Java数组02——三种初始化及内存分析
  6. SpringCloud升级之路2020.0.x版-9.如何理解并定制一个Spring Cloud组件
  7. 在游戏中播放cg视频遇到的问题
  8. 一文让你彻底掌握ArcGisJS地图管理的秘密
  9. linux copy_id
  10. system V信号量和Posix信号量